Family ties often fade into the background amidst the noise of everyday ambition and pressure. ‘Sarahana’, the moving directorial debut of Sunil Subramani (former chief assistant director on ‘Barfi’), brings into sharp focus the most overlooked relationship of all, the one we share with our parents. Drawing from the rhythms of daily life, this heartfelt short film gently reminds us of the unconditional love parents give, often quietly and steadfastly.

The story opens with a young professional, preoccupied with the pursuit of work and success, habitually ignoring his mother’s calls even as he sits in a waiting room for an important interview. This initial moment sets off a subtle exploration of priorities and regrets, as the protagonist is led to reassess his relationship with his mother during a candid conversation with his interviewer. What follows is a touching journey back home, revealing the grace of small gestures and the profound meaning that lies in simply spending time together.

Why Watch ‘Sarahana’?

  • A Mirror to Modern Relationships

‘Sarahana’ thoughtfully examines how the demands of modern life can distance us from the people who matter most. Through relatable situations and honest dialogue, the film invites us all to reflect on our own connections with family and the moments we too easily keep on hold.

  • The Power of Small Gestures

One of the film’s most poignant scenes sees the protagonist tending to his mother’s sore palm. The simple act of applying ointment carries an emotional weight, becoming emblematic of gratitude, empathy, and love that is often best expressed wordlessly. In showing how little acts can carry immense significance, the film champions the everyday over the grand gesture.

  • Emotional Realism and Authenticity

Avoiding melodrama, ‘Sarahana’ relies on authentic, understated moments to generate resonance. The candid exchanges at home, the hesitations during phone calls, and the sincere tears all build a truly believable portrayal of a mother and her adult son navigating the complexities of care and independence.

  • A Reminder to Value What Matters

The film’s climax comes when the protagonist, in the middle of another tense interview, finally acknowledges his mother’s call, choosing family over protocol. This decision earns him not only the job but also a deeper understanding of himself. It powerfully underscores the lesson that success is sweetest when our relationships with those who matter are cherished.
